Exotropia
A form of strabismus where one or both eyes turn outward away from the nose.
Optic Disks
The point of exit for ganglion cell axons leaving the eye, also known as the optic nerve head.
Blind Spots
Areas in which a person's view is obstructed, or in a broader sense, areas of knowledge or understanding that are lacking or not perceived.
Macular Degeneration
A progressive eye condition affecting the macula of the retina, leading to loss of central vision.
